The Sweet and Sour of Travel Agent Fees


One of the most frequently asked questions by emerging and prospective travel agents is, "are travel agent fees common?" Here's the succinct answer: Yes, they are! However, there's more nuance to the story. While many travel agents indeed impose fees, the structure and amount of these fees can vary wildly. These costs can take the form of consultation fees, planning fees, transaction fees, or bespoke service fees - all of which form an integral part of the comprehensive travel guide to understanding travel agency operations.


A Deep Dive into The Rationale for Travel Agent Fees


Now that you're aware that travel agent fees are quite commonplace, you might be wondering why. Why do travel agents impose these costs on their customers? The answer lies in the value-added services they provide.


Remember, a travel agent's role isn't confined to merely booking tickets or hotels. They offer tailored advice, personalized service, and manage the evitable hiccups that come along any travel journey. Their expertise and skills save customers time and ease the stress associated with holiday planning – and this relief comes with a price tag, otherwise known as the travel agent’s fee.


Navigating Through the Landscape of Travel Agency Costs


As we delve deeper into our extensively researched travel industry analysis, intricate details start to unfold about travel agency costs. The fees imposed by travel agents can be categorized into two main types: Basic and Custom.


Basic fees usually are comparatively low and are charged for straightforward services like booking air tickets, hotel rooms, and tour packages. On the other hand, custom fees, which could be high, are levied for personalization and customization of travel plans tailored as per the unique preferences and expectations of each client.


The key takeaway here is that understanding the fee structure is fundamental for any aspiring or established travel agent. It is an essential part of the business model and plays a pivotal role in determining the profitability of the operation.
